Print cost on the Prusa Mini+

The Mini+ is Prusa's compact printer — 180 mm cubed, cartesian, stable platform and the Prusa firmware. Small on purpose: many makers buy two or three Mini+ for the price of one MK4 and run them in parallel. Prusa family maintenance and quality in a smaller form factor.

When this printer makes sense

The Mini+ is Prusa's compact entry for makers who want into the Prusa Research ecosystem (open-source, PrusaSlicer, long-term support) without committing to the MK4S budget. 180 × 180 × 180 mm volume — very similar to the Bambu A1 Mini in usable footprint. Prusa ships direct from Czechia at $429 kit / $549 assembled. Makes sense for makers who value open-source philosophy and Prusa's long support window over Bambu's plug-and-play convenience.

Strengths and limitations

Strengths

Compact footprint — fits anywhere. Prusa Research support measured in years (5+ years of replacement parts). PrusaSlicer is the best slicer on the market by a wide margin — fine control others don't offer. Modular hardware: upgrade to MMU3 (multi-material) later. Robust reprap community in English with thousands of guides.

Limitations

Direct import has all the drawbacks of MK4S: unpredictable customs, international warranty, 2-6 week wait. No direct drive — Bowden extruder limits TPU (works with aggressive tuning). 280 °C hotend covers PETG but doesn't reach reliable ABS. 180 mm³ build volume is small — doesn't compete with the full A1 or K1.

Typical print cost

A 25 g PLA part on the Mini+ costs $0.20-0.30 per unit in a 10-batch with amortization over $429. Compared to the A1 Mini at $299, the Mini+ runs slightly higher in ROI due to the larger acquisition cost. But for makers who reject closed ecosystems and want to invest in a machine that will still have replacement parts in 2030, the premium pays off.

Cost by job type

Estimated cost to make and recommended sell price for common jobs on the Prusa Mini+:

JobMaterialWeightPrint timeCost to makeSell price
Small keychainPLA5 g30 min$0.14$0.60
Miniature / figurinePLA25 g2 h$0.68$2.94
Functional bracketPETG80 g4 h$2.32$10.10
Large vase / planterPLA200 g8 h$5.08$22.08

Assumptions: canonical filament prices, 8% failure rate, 3× markup, 6% tax, 2% payment fee. Currency follows your selection at the top.
